Leszek Kmiecik Project Manager
Temat: Problem z jQuery.noConflict();
Witajcie,chyba to jest najodpowiedniejsza grupa, żeby rozwiązać mój problem, który polega na najprawdopodobniej z konfliktem jQuery.
Korzystam z joomli 1.5 i chciałem dołożyć na stronę dodatek (http://extensions.joomla.org/extensions/photos-a-image.... Na stronie posiadam już 2 moduły zawierające jQuery i w treści kodu mam wstawione:
</script>
<script type="text/javascript">
jQuery.noConflict();
</script>
i wszystko działało bez problemu, po wstawieniu ww. dodatku niestety nie działa jak należy i nie potrafię znaleźć problemu.
Adres strony przed instalacją dodatku: http://gdziezpsem.com.pl
Adres strony po instalacji dodatku: http://kmiecik.net.pl/gdzie/
Adres strony przy instalacji dodatku na "świeżej" joomli (działa bez problemu): http://kmiecik.net.pl/test/
Dotychczas z jQuery korzystała mapka po lewej stronie oraz slider na pasku pod głównym oknem.
Czy jakaś dobra osoba nakieruje mnie na problem?
Z góry dzięki.Leszek Kmiecik edytował(a) ten post dnia 05.10.11 o godzinie 16:47
Andrzej
Winnicki
Frontend Architect,
Developer &
Magician
Temat: Problem z jQuery.noConflict();
Nie odpowiem na Twoj problem, ale moge skomentowac jedno: burdel jaki jest na tej stronie mnie przerazil :) mootools, cufon, jquery (sugeruje najnowsza wersje przynajmniej) + 3 miliardy innych bibliotek, ktore sluza glownie zasmiecaniu. Serio... to nie jest normalne by taka stronka, w sumie dosc podstawowa, ladowala az 21 plikow javascriptu!
Tomasz Zadora extends Human
Temat: Problem z jQuery.noConflict();
Ok to dla kontrastu, bez programistycznego "zobaczenia" powiem, że strona jest ładna - od strony wizualnej i nawet dość funkcjonalna.Jednak budowanie serwisu w ten sposób, że instaluje się kilkanaście gotowców/komponentów i z każdego używa tylko części funkcji nieuchronnie powoduje tego typu problemy których rozwiązanie często nie jest banalne.
Np. jeżeli używasz jQuery to możesz w nim zrobić praktycznie wszystko co jest w mootools.
Potrzebujesz np. jakiegoś menu rozwijanego i interaktywnej mapki ? Nie rób tak, że menu masz w jQuery a mapkę w mootools, zrób wszystko na jednej bibliotece.
Podejrzewam, że podobnie jest z backendem.
Na serwisach typu goldenline czy innych forach poświęconych stronom www możesz otrzymać pomoc jeżeli rozwiązanie problemu jest proste, ale tutaj potrzeba kogoś kto to wszystko uporządkuje i zbuduje system bez tych wszystkich nadmiarowych rzeczy.Tomasz Zadora edytował(a) ten post dnia 07.10.11 o godzinie 16:07
